The Anatomy of a Plumbing Emergency
Understanding what constitutes a plumbing emergency is the first step in responding effectively. Common scenarios include:
- Burst Pipes: Often caused by freezing temperatures or corrosion, leading to significant water damage.
- Sewer Backups: Unpleasant and hazardous, indicating a blockage in the main sewer line.
- Overflowing Toilets: Can cause water damage and pose health risks if not addressed promptly.
- No Hot Water: Especially problematic during colder months, affecting daily routines.
- Gas Leaks: Extremely dangerous, requiring immediate attention to prevent potential explosions or health hazards.
Recognizing these issues early and responding swiftly can mitigate damage and restore normalcy.
Immediate Steps to Take
When faced with a plumbing emergency, taking the following steps can help control the situation:
- Shut Off the Water Supply: Locate the main water valve and turn it off to prevent further flooding.
- Turn Off the Water Heater: To avoid damage, switch off the heater to prevent overheating or bursting.
- Open Drains and Spigots: This helps to drain any remaining water in the pipes, reducing pressure.
- Address Small Leaks: Use towels or buckets to contain minor leaks until professional help arrives.
- Call a Professional Plumber: Engage a certified plumber to assess and fix the issue promptly.

Preventive Measures for the Future
While emergencies are often unforeseen, certain preventive measures can reduce the risk:
- Regular Maintenance: Schedule periodic inspections to identify and fix potential issues.
- Insulate Pipes: Especially in colder regions, to prevent freezing and bursting.
- Proper Disposal Practices: Avoid flushing non-degradable items or pouring grease down the drain.
- Install Leak Detectors: These devices can alert you to leaks before they become major problems.
